Visit an outdoor ice-skating rink

Winter is the season when outdoor ice-skating rinks come to life. If you live close to one (or are willing to travel), you should gather everyone together and head on down. Just remember to be careful and mindful of other people when you’re out on the ice. Also, if you’ve never ice-skated before, don’t be tempted to go zooming around on the ice, as it can take time to master.

Go sledding

Sledding has existed for decades, and it never gets boring. Even if you consider yourself to be ‘old’, that shouldn’t stop you from getting out there and having some fun. After all, winter only comes around once a year, so you should make the most of it.
